Using Apache with mod_jk

It's not possible to use only mod_jk to proxy Confluence 6.0 or later. This is because Synchrony, which is required for collaborative editing, cannot accept AJP connections. The preferred configuration is Using Apache with mod_proxy.
If you are unable to switch to mod_proxy, see [ARCHIVED] How to configure Apache mod_jk to proxy Confluence 6.x or later for a workaround.
